Benefits of Serverless Applications

Benefits of Serverless Applications

Serverless applications reshape how teams design and deploy solutions. They align costs with usage, removing idle capacity and enabling precise resource provisioning. Real-time auto-scaling and modular components shorten feedback loops and accelerate delivery. Decoupled services promote cross-functional autonomy while maintaining governance and security. The approach mitigates performance risk during spikes and supports continuous improvement, offering future-ready flexibility with varied tooling and clear exit strategies to avoid vendor lock-in. The next step is worth considering.

What Serverless Really Changes About App Architecture

Serverless shifts the core of application architecture from provisioning and managing servers to designing around event-driven resources and scalable services. It reframes how components interact, emphasizing modularity and asynchronous workflows. This shift enables rapid iteration and resilient systems, where scalability guarantees emerge from elastic execution. The focus becomes event driven design, aligning architecture with autonomous, demand-responsive behavior and future-ready freedom.

How Serverless Cuts Costs and Manages Scale for You

From a cost and scalability perspective, serverless architectures automatically align expenses with actual usage, eliminating idle capacity and enabling precise resource provisioning. This approach delivers cost efficiency by charging only for consumed compute and storage, while auto scaling adjusts capacity in real time.

Stakeholders gain predictable budgeting, rapid alignment with demand, and freedom to innovate without overprovisioning or performance risk.

How Serverless Speeds up Delivery and Innovation

The move from variable costs and scalable capacity to rapid delivery and ongoing innovation follows naturally as teams harness the automation and event-driven patterns inherent in serverless architectures. Latency reduction accelerates feedback loops, enabling faster release cycles.

This approach expands developer autonomy, empowering cross-functional teams to ship features with fewer bottlenecks while maintaining governance.

Strategic, forward-looking momentum fuels continuous product improvement and competitive advantage.

Practical Considerations for Adopting Serverless Today

Organizations evaluating serverless today must balance cost clarity, operational control, and architectural fit to ensure a smooth transition from monoliths or containerized approaches. Pragmatic adoption considerations emphasize early cost governance, observable SLAs, and modular design to minimize adoption pitfalls. Vigilance against vendor lock in promotes diversified tooling, open standards, and clear exit strategies for sustained freedom and resilient, future-ready architectures.

Frequently Asked Questions

How Does Security Differ in Serverless Environments?

Security posture in serverless environments hinges on granular authorization models, automated policy enforcement, and continuous threat monitoring; architecture favors least privilege, immutable configurations, and rapid incident response, enabling freedom-seeking teams to innovate while maintaining disciplined security governance.

What Are the Main Vendor Lock-In Risks?

Vendor lockin and platform dependency pose primary risks, as teams risk reduced portability and bargaining power. Strategically, they should diversify architectures, adopt open standards, and design for portability to preserve freedom and future adaptability.

How Do Debugging and Observability Work at Scale?

Debugging observability at scale hinges on standardized traces, metrics, and logs; automation surfaces anomalies early, while instrumentation evolves with architecture. Scalability challenges demand proactive, vendor-agnostic tooling, backward-compatible schemas, and freedom-driven governance to sustain resilient, observable systems.

What Are Best Practices for Data Persistence in Serverless?

Data persistence best practices guide resilient architectures; serverless durability challenges are anticipated and mitigated through idempotent design, reliable storage options, and clear data access patterns. The stance emphasizes freedom to evolve while ensuring consistent, scalable outcomes.

See also: How Blockchain Supports Web3 Applications

How Do You Handle Cold Starts Consistently?

To handle cold starts consistently, teams implement proactive cold start mitigation and function impersonation strategies, ensuring predictable latency while maintaining freedom to innovate; it avoids panic, positions architecture for scale, and aligns with autonomous, forward-looking development.

Conclusion

Serverless shifts the architectural rhythm, nudging teams toward leaner, more modular designs. It quietly lowers cost and scales with demand, reducing risk during peak moments and expanding innovation avenues. By decoupling components, organizations gain agility without sacrificing governance. The path forward invites disciplined experimentation, clear exit strategies, and diversified tooling. In embracing this approach, enterprises position themselves to respond faster, optimize continuously, and weather uncertainty with composed, forward-looking resilience.